In what felt like a throwback to a bygone period, the NASCAR Cup Collection carried out a 90-minute follow session on Friday prematurely of Sunday’s All-Star Race at Dover Motor Speedway.
For drivers who have been a part of the game previous to COVID-19, when the Sanctioning Physique first began consolidating race weekends, Friday was a time capsule of sports activities. was round again then and turned essentially the most laps round The Moster Mile throughout follow.

Mix that with the added bills of turning further laps and shopping for extra occasions or an additional resort keep 36 weekends a yr, and because of this NASCAR nixed prolonged follow classes.
Regardless, is alone amongst NASCAR Cup Collection crew homeowners, and believes the dearth of observe time each weekend is the fallacious course.
“As a driver and an proprietor, it’s essential to the well being of the game,” Keselowski stated of follow. “Not having it’s a massive miss for guiding the celebrities of the longer term. It’s a giant miss for a way groups finances.

“I’ve made my peace and stated my peace in several settings and a majority of the homeowners don’t need follow. So I really feel like, in some unspecified time in the future, NASCAR is simply going to need to robust arm homeowners and say ‘we’re working towards and y’all want to determine learn how to pay for it’ as a result of that’s what is finest for the game and for the followers.
“It’s what’s finest for the drivers which are developing and for crew homeowners who’re attempting to compete at a excessive stage that are not the place they need to be.”
